NCT ID: NCT03858894 Completed - Clinical trials for Primary Open-angle Glaucoma and Ocular Hypertension

Study Assessing the Safety and Efficacy of DE-117 Ophthalmic Solution Once Daily and Twice Daily in Subjects With Primary Open-Angle Glaucoma SPECTRUM 6

Start date: January 28, 2019
Phase: Phase 2
Study type: Interventional

This is a randomized, double-masked, parallel-group, multi-center study. Subjects diagnosed with POAG or OHT who meet eligibility criteria at Visit 1 (Screening) will wash out their current topical IOP lowering medication(s), if any. After completing the required washout period, subjects will return for Visit 2 (Baseline, Day 1). Subjects who meet all eligibility criteria at Visit 2 (Baseline, Day 1) will be randomized to receive study medication for up to 6 weeks. Approximately 100 subjects with POAG or OHT will be randomized in a 1:1 ratio to either: - DE-117 ophthalmic solution 0.002% QD (Once Daily) - DE-117 ophthalmic solution 0.002% BID (Twice Daily) This study will consist of a screening period of up to 35 days including a washout period of up to 28 days (+ 7 days window), and a 6-week double-masked treatment period.

NCT ID: NCT03850054 Terminated - Glaucoma Clinical Trials

AADI Glaucoma Shunt - a Quality Control Study

Start date: March 4, 2019
Phase:
Study type: Observational [Patient Registry]

To prospectively investigate the effect and safety of implantation of the AADI glaucoma tube in eyes with medically intractable glaucoma in the period 2019 to 2020, at the Department of Ophthalmology, Odense University Hospital. The device will be implanted in eyes instead of the Bearveldt drainage device. Patients and data are prospectively registered to evaluate the effect and safety of the AADI device.

NCT ID: NCT03822559 Completed - Clinical trials for Open-angle Glaucoma, Ocular Hypertension

A Study of DE-111A on the Treatment of Open Angle Glaucoma or Ocular Hypertension

Start date: January 20, 2019
Phase: Phase 3
Study type: Interventional

The objective of this study is to investigate whether the IOP (intraocular pressure) -lowering effect of DE-111A (preservative-free fixed dose combination of 0.0015% tafluprost and 0.5% timolol eye drops, administered one drop a time, once daily for 3 months) is superior to the monotherapy of tafluprost 0.0015% eye drops administered one drop a time, once daily for 3 months) in subjects with open-angle glaucoma or ocular hypertension in China as well as comparison of safety.
